Education and Training Requirements

To become an industrial electrician, specific educational and training requirements must be met:

  1. High School Diploma or GED: A foundational requirement for entering the field is a high school diploma or equivalent, with a focus on mathematics, physics, and technical subjects.
  2. Formal Education: Many aspiring electricians pursue an associate degree in electrical technology or a related field. This education provides essential theoretical knowledge and practical skills.
  3. Apprenticeship Programs: Completing an apprenticeship is a critical step. These programs typically last 4-5 years and combine on-the-job training with classroom instruction. Apprentices learn from experienced electricians, gaining hands-on experience in various industrial settings.

Certifications and Licenses

In addition to education and training, obtaining the necessary certifications and licenses is essential:

  • State Licensure: Most states require electricians to obtain a license to work legally. This often involves passing an exam that tests knowledge of electrical codes, safety regulations, and practical skills.
  • Certifications: Additional certifications, such as those offered by the National Institute for Certification in Engineering Technologies (NICET) or the International Brotherhood of Electrical Workers (IBEW), can enhance job prospects and demonstrate expertise.

Career Path of an Industrial Electrician

Entry-Level Positions

The journey to becoming an industrial electrician typically begins with entry-level positions that provide foundational experience and skills. These roles often include:

  1. Electrical Apprentice: As an apprentice, individuals work under the supervision of licensed electricians. This position involves hands-on training, learning about electrical systems, and assisting in installations and repairs.
  2. Maintenance Electrician: In this role, electricians focus on maintaining and repairing existing electrical systems in industrial settings. Responsibilities may include troubleshooting equipment failures and performing routine inspections.
  3. Electrical Technician: Technicians often assist in the installation and testing of electrical systems. They may also work on troubleshooting and repairing electrical components, gaining valuable experience in the field.

Evolution of the Role with Experience

As industrial electricians gain experience, their roles evolve significantly:

  1. Journeyman Electrician: After completing an apprenticeship and obtaining a license, electricians become journeymen. They can work independently, take on more complex projects, and may begin to specialize in areas such as automation or renewable energy.
  2. Master Electrician: With additional experience and further certification, electricians can become master electricians. This role often involves overseeing projects, managing teams, and ensuring compliance with electrical codes and regulations.
  3. Specialized Roles: Electricians may choose to specialize in fields such as industrial automation, robotics, or energy management. These roles often come with higher salaries and increased responsibilities.

Salary Expectations

Salary expectations for industrial electricians can vary based on experience, location, and specialization:

  • Entry-Level Electricians: Typically earn between $30,000 and $45,000 annually, depending on the region and industry.
  • Journeyman Electricians: Can expect salaries ranging from $45,000 to $65,000, with opportunities for overtime and bonuses.
  • Master Electricians: Often earn between $65,000 and $90,000 or more, particularly in specialized fields or management roles.

Job Growth Projections

The job outlook for industrial electricians is positive, with growth projections indicating a steady demand for skilled professionals:

  • Overall Growth: According to the U.S. Bureau of Labor Statistics, employment for electricians is projected to grow by about 8% from 2019 to 2029, which is faster than the average for all occupations.
  • Regional Variations: Job growth may vary by region, with areas experiencing industrial expansion or infrastructure development seeing higher demand for electricians.

Challenges in the Field

While a career as an industrial electrician can be rewarding, it also comes with its challenges:

  • Physical Demands: The job often requires physical stamina, as electricians may need to lift heavy equipment, work in confined spaces, or stand for long periods.
  • Safety Risks: Working with electricity poses inherent risks, including electrical shocks and falls. Adhering to safety protocols is crucial.
  • Technological Changes: As technology evolves, electricians must continually update their skills and knowledge to keep pace with new systems and equipment.
  • Work Environment: Electricians may work in challenging environments, including extreme temperatures or hazardous conditions, depending on the industry.
